import java.math.BigInteger; import java.nio.charset.StandardCharsets; import java.util.Arrays; import java.util.stream.Collectors; public final class BitcoinPublicPointToAddess { public static void main(String[] args) { String x = "50863AD64A87AE8A2FE83C1AF1A8403CB53F53E486D8511DAD8A04887E5B2352"; String y = "2CD470243453A299FA9E77237716103ABC11A1DF38855ED6F2EE187E9C582BA6"; if ( areValidCoordinates(x, y) ) { System.out.println(encodeAddress(x, y)); } else { System.out.println("Invalid Bitcoin public point coordinates"); } } // Return the encoded address of the given coordinates. private static String encodeAddress(String x, String y) { String publicPoint = BITCOIN_SPECIAL_VALUE + x + y; if ( publicPoint.length() != 130 ) { throw new AssertionError("Invalid public point string: " + publicPoint); } byte[] messageBytes = computeMessageBytes(publicPoint); byte[] checksum = computeChecksum(messageBytes); messageBytes = Arrays.copyOf(messageBytes, messageBytes.length + 4); System.arraycopy(checksum, 0, messageBytes, 21, checksum.length); return encodeBase58(messageBytes); } // Return the given byte array encoded into a base58 starting with most one '1' private static String encodeBase58(byte[] bytes) { final String ALPHABET = "123456789ABCDEFGHJKLMNPQRSTUVWXYZabcdefghijkmnopqrstuvwxyz"; final int ALPHABET_SIZE = ALPHABET.length(); String[] temp = new String[34]; for ( int n = temp.length - 1; n >= 0; n-- ) { int c = 0; for ( int i = 0; i < bytes.length; i++ ) { c = c * 256 + (int) ( bytes[i] & 0xFF ); bytes[i] = (byte) ( c / ALPHABET_SIZE ); c %= ALPHABET_SIZE; } temp[n] = ALPHABET.substring(c, c + 1); } String result = Arrays.stream(temp).collect(Collectors.joining("")); while ( result.startsWith("11") ) { result = result.substring(1); } return result; } // Return whether the given coordinates are those of a point on the secp256k1 elliptic curve private static boolean areValidCoordinates(String x, String y) { BigInteger modulus = new BigInteger("FFFFFFFFFFFFFFFFFFFFFFFFFFFFFFFFFFFFFFFFFFFFFFFFFFFFFFFEFFFFFC2F", 16); BigInteger X = new BigInteger(x, 16); BigInteger Y = new BigInteger(y, 16); return Y.multiply(Y).mod(modulus).equals(X.multiply(X).multiply(X).add(BigInteger.valueOf(7)).mod(modulus)); } private static byte[] computeMessageBytes(String text) { // Convert the hexadecimal string 'text' into a suitable ASCII string for the SHA256 hash byte[] bytesOne = hexToBytes(text); String asciiOne = new String(bytesOne, StandardCharsets.ISO_8859_1); String hexSHA256 = SHA256.messageDigest(asciiOne); // Convert the hexadecimal string 'hexSHA256' into a suitable ASCII string for the RIPEMD160 hash byte[] bytesTwo = hexToBytes(hexSHA256); String asciiTwo = new String(bytesTwo, StandardCharsets.ISO_8859_1); String hexRIPEMD160 = BITCOIN_VERSION_NUMBER + RIPEMD160.messageDigest(asciiTwo); return hexToBytes(hexRIPEMD160); } private static byte[] computeChecksum(byte[] bytes) { // Convert the given byte array into a suitable ASCII string for the first SHA256 hash String asciiOne = new String(bytes, StandardCharsets.ISO_8859_1); String hexOne = SHA256.messageDigest(asciiOne); // Convert the hexadecimal string 'hex1' into a suitable ASCII string for the second SHA256 hash byte[] bytesOne = hexToBytes(hexOne); String asciiTwo = new String(bytesOne, StandardCharsets.ISO_8859_1); String hexTwo = SHA256.messageDigest(asciiTwo); return Arrays.copyOfRange(hexToBytes(hexTwo), 0, 4); } private static byte[] hexToBytes(String text) { byte[] bytes = new byte[text.length() / 2]; for ( int i = 0; i < text.length(); i += 2 ) { final int firstDigit = Character.digit(text.charAt(i), 16); final int secondDigit = Character.digit(text.charAt(i + 1), 16); bytes[i / 2] = (byte) ( ( firstDigit << 4 ) + secondDigit );; } return bytes; } private static final String BITCOIN_SPECIAL_VALUE = "04"; private static final String BITCOIN_VERSION_NUMBER = "00"; }
